Ошибка Json: невозможно изменить информацию заголовка — заголовки уже отправлены на Aws-bitnamiPhp

Кемеровские программисты php общаются здесь
Ответить Пред. темаСлед. тема
Anonymous
 Ошибка Json: невозможно изменить информацию заголовка — заголовки уже отправлены на Aws-bitnami

Сообщение Anonymous »

Запросы относительно журналов в следующем формате, вероятно, являются наиболее распространенными из-за ошибок json, связанных с WordPress.

[Чт, 25 июля 13:00:50.367263 2024] [proxy_fcgi:error] [pid 26574:tid 140437025085120] [client xxx.it.is.myIp:50810] AH01071: возникла ошибка '; Сообщение PHP: Предупреждение PHP: невозможно изменить информацию заголовка — заголовки уже отправлены в /opt/bitnami/apache/htdocs/MY-WEB-1stDOMAIN-FOLDER/wp-includes/rest-api/class-wp-rest-server.php на линия 1831; Сообщение PHP: Предупреждение PHP: невозможно изменить информацию заголовка — заголовки уже отправлены в /opt/bitnami/apache/htdocs/MY-WEB-1stDOMAIN-FOLDER/wp-includes/rest-api/class-wp-rest-server.php на строка 1831;

В моем случае журнал ошибок связан с «Неверной ошибкой JSON» (или «Ошибкой получения JSON при попытке загрузки изображений» ). Я уже знаю несколько общих советов по решению этой проблемы. И я попробовал его запустить.
Например:
  • Рассмотрим конфликты плагинов в вашем Wordpress. Поэтому я отключил/деактивировал все плагины и просмотрел их один за другим.
  • Рассмотрите уникальную ссылку (постоянные ссылки) сообщения в вашем WordPress. панель настроек. Поэтому я попытался перейти от обычных постоянных ссылок к постоянным ссылкам формата заголовка сообщения (или наоборот).
  • Удалите пробелы в PHP-коде. Поэтому я попытался удалить пробелы из файлов моих пользовательских функций (например, function.php дочерней темы). И я даже пытался вручную заменить все файлы ресурсов WordPress через FTP.
  • Восстановить файл WordPress .htaccess. Поэтому я восстановил .htaccess по умолчанию в Wordpress.
  • и т. д.
Но проблема не решена. Поэтому я подумал, что это проблема с абсолютным путем или перенаправлением веб-сервера. Это связано с тем, что эта проблема возникла после перехода на сервер Aws Bitnami.
Как известно тем из вас, кто использовал его, служба LAMP Bitnami в настоящее время предоставляет веб-корень для файла /opt/bitnami. /apache/htdocs/' путь. Это означает, что «htdocs» представляет собой базовый веб-каталог для статического IP-адреса. А в «httpd.conf» или «bitnami.conf» этот каталог по умолчанию/базовый принимается как веб-http. Затем пользователь хоста может быть распределен по каталогам доменов нескольких сайтов через vhost.conf. (MY-WEB-1stDOMAIN-FOLDER, MY-WEB-2ndDOMAIN-FOLDER, MY-WEB-3rdDOMAIN-FOLDER...)
И между этой структурой URL-адреса обрабатываются путем вмешательства в адрес сертифицированного домена через ssl.conf.
Итак,
  • Я также несколько раз просматривал эти файлы, которые обрабатывают URL-адреса и адреса нескольких доменов. (В настоящее время нет проблем с доступом к каждой папке/сайту каждого экрана WordPress с использованием этих нескольких доменов.)
  • Конечно, я также применил все разрешения для каталога WordPress, в котором предлагает битнами инженер. (например: chown -R bitnami:daemon 'htdocs' или 'MY-WEB-1stDOMAIN-FOLDER')
Однако я не могу устранить ошибки, которые появляются в «Ошибке получения JSON при попытке загрузки изображений» или в этом файле error.logs.
Эта ошибка обычно возникает при редактировании сообщения WordPress. Это происходит не с каждым постом. Это происходит с некоторыми сообщениями, а не с другими (я слышал, что это проблема, связанная с редактором блоков WordPress Gutenberg). Однако, независимо от Гутенберга, ошибки Json возникают в 100% случаев при загрузке изображений.
Нет проблем с редактированием сообщений, загрузкой и сохранением результата изображений. Эта ошибка просто появляется.
Некоторые рекомендуют классический плагин редактора Wordpress, но я не хочу решать эту проблему таким образом.
Не могу не думать, что это конструктивный недостаток редактора в WordPress(или битнами?), что ошибка не исчезает даже после различных проверок и действий. Что вы думаете? (Есть ли способ решить эту проблему путем настройки/изменения пути Bitnami?)
Обратите внимание: я не использовал (мульти) приложение WordPress, входящее в пакет Bitnami, но установил его вручную. каждый WordPress в каждой папке экземпляра LAMP. (Помимо WordPress 6.6.1, который я установил сам, все версии PHP 8.x, MariaDB 10.x..., предоставленные AWS, являются последними версиями.)
Спасибо. заранее за ваш комментарий.

Подробнее здесь: https://stackoverflow.com/questions/787 ... -aws-bitna
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Получение «Заголовки уже отправлены» с помощью TCPDF
    Anonymous » » в форуме Php
    0 Ответы
    8 Просмотры
    Последнее сообщение Anonymous
  • Как решить "session_regenerate_id (): не может регенерировать идентификатор сеанса - заголовки уже отправлены"
    Anonymous » » в форуме Php
    0 Ответы
    10 Просмотры
    Последнее сообщение Anonymous
  • Symfony 6 / Symfony 1 Cohabitation "не удалось запустить сессию, Because Заголовки уже отправлены"
    Anonymous » » в форуме Php
    0 Ответы
    6 Просмотры
    Последнее сообщение Anonymous
  • Пользовательская страница ошибки HTTP 500 для стека Bitnami LAMP на AWS Lightsail
    Anonymous » » в форуме Apache
    0 Ответы
    86 Просмотры
    Последнее сообщение Anonymous
  • Загрузите файл Bitnami Wordpress в .well-known, обслуживаемый через application/json.
    Anonymous » » в форуме IOS
    0 Ответы
    22 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Php»